Ex Min Dr Manohar criticizes 'anti Dalit' attitude of Modi led BJP regime | | | Early Times Report
Jammu, Apr 28: Senior Congress leader, former minister and General Secretary Pradesh Congress Committee (PCC) Dr Manohar Lal Sharma accused BJP government for deliberately ignoring Dalit representation in power sharing in the constitutional institutions at both center and state governments. Dr Sharma criticized the shedding of crocodile tears by Mr Modi and its leadership on dalit affairs and its utmost try to show them their great sympathizers only in saying not in action. Modi led government is always trying to befool the nation by not missing any occasion in the name of Dr Bhim Rao Ambedkar Bharat Rattan. "But in reality he (Mr ModI) is not prepare to give proper representation in power and decision making body to any of Dalit leader even after the completion of two years in government, he said. Dr Sharma said whereas the Congress government whether it was in states or in center not only give due representation to the Dalit community leaders but also give important positions in the government which shows that congress believe on equal power sharing in democracy but the BJP regime has failed to give any representation to the Dailt at centre and state regime. Congress leader Dr Sharma further said Mr Modi is aptly fit to old saying "Jo Garajte Hain woh Baraste Nahin" and many other things which had spoken by him in Loud and clear style but there is nothing in actual seen on ground even after completion of two years is this was Gujrat's Modi Model? |
